Description
This is the stack writer script for my automatic advanced furnace.
You will first need to load and run the stack writer script on the controller chip before overwriting it with the controller script.

Update 4/9/2022: Increased tolerances for thermodynamics update.
Update 9/4/2023: Adjusted tolerances for stellite

CowsAreEvil  [author] 5 Sep, 2021 @ 11:45pm 
Stellite has a very high smelting temperature so it will have difficulty heating the existing has in the furnace high enough. So it will dump most of the gas and then refill from the hot tank. If you increase the temperature of the hot tank it will need to dump less of the gas before refilling.
